Read more →Rockets Glare Rosé® is a sweet rosé with cherry on the nose, bright red cherries on the palate, and green apple on the finish. Made from Sabrevois and La Crosse grapes grown in our Mahaska County, Iowa, vineyards, pair Rockets Glare Rosé with your favorite spicy foods.
